ca.h.rst.exceptions 919 B

12345678910111213141516171819202122232425
  1. # SPDX-License-Identifier: GPL-2.0
  2. # Ignore header name
  3. ignore define _DVBCA_H_
  4. # struct ca_slot_info defines
  5. replace define CA_CI :c:type:`ca_slot_info`
  6. replace define CA_CI_LINK :c:type:`ca_slot_info`
  7. replace define CA_CI_PHYS :c:type:`ca_slot_info`
  8. replace define CA_DESCR :c:type:`ca_slot_info`
  9. replace define CA_SC :c:type:`ca_slot_info`
  10. replace define CA_CI_MODULE_PRESENT :c:type:`ca_slot_info`
  11. replace define CA_CI_MODULE_READY :c:type:`ca_slot_info`
  12. # struct ca_descr_info defines
  13. replace define CA_ECD :c:type:`ca_descr_info`
  14. replace define CA_NDS :c:type:`ca_descr_info`
  15. replace define CA_DSS :c:type:`ca_descr_info`
  16. # some typedefs should point to struct/enums
  17. replace typedef ca_slot_info_t :c:type:`ca_slot_info`
  18. replace typedef ca_descr_info_t :c:type:`ca_descr_info`
  19. replace typedef ca_caps_t :c:type:`ca_caps`
  20. replace typedef ca_msg_t :c:type:`ca_msg`
  21. replace typedef ca_descr_t :c:type:`ca_descr`